## DocLintr v3.4.1 — Changelog

Rotated the plugin signing key following our quarterly schedule. Old key expires in 30 days. Plugin authors must re-sign packages before the cutoff or installs will fail validation. No API changes. The new public verification key is published below for your build pipelines.

signing key of bagap-yawep = bky13_TbfT6ZMUoGJo2

Handover Note – Directors, Pellwright Logistics

Branch managers: I'm handing the Q3 cash-flow forecast to my successor effective Friday. Key points. Receivables are slower than modelled; Delmont branch is the main drag. Payables stretched to 45 days — do not extend further. Fuel hedge rolls off in week 9; expect margin pressure. Capex is frozen except safety items. Forecast file sits in the shared planning folder, version 6 is current. Flag variances over 5% weekly, no exceptions. The confidential note on forward plans follows directly below.

management briefing: Only 5 of the 80 pilot accounts renewed Zorix, so a churn review is set for October 1.

Ticket: Exporter in Cartonly silently drops failed CSV exports instead of retrying. Users see "complete" status while files never land in the delivery bucket. Cause: the retry wrapper swallows non-timeout errors and marks the job done. Proposed fix: classify upload errors as retryable, cap at five attempts with backoff, and surface terminal failures in the UI. Maintainers note: the status enum is shared with the import path, so migrate carefully. The failing run we reproduced is traceable via the token below.

trace token, kahog-tajeg: htk6_97d963